Equinor and Polenergia owned joint venture companies leading the development of the 1440MW Baltyk 2&3 offshore wind farms in the Baltic Sea, have signed a capacity reservation and early works agreement with the consortium of Smulders Projects Belgium NV and Sif Netherlands BV, for the manufacturing of 100 transition pieces for both projects.
The sites are two separate projects with planned installed capacities of 720MW each (jointly 1.4GW).
The offshore wind farms will be installed in Polish exclusive economic zone of the Baltic Sea and are subject to Polish regulatory regime.
The sites are located approximately 37km (Baltyk 2) and 22km (Baltyk 3) off the Polish coast.
The scope of work for the consortium of Smulders and Sif consists of fabrication of the Transition Pieces including shop design, procurement, construction, testing and commissioning.
Within the consortium Sif will manufacture the approximately 30kton primary steel tubulars, including flanges, from their facility in Roermond, The Netherlands.
Smulders will perform the secondary steel scope, coating, electrical system and testing and commissioning. The secondary steel scope will be produced by the Polish facilities of Smulders.
Final assembly will take place at the yard in Hoboken, Belgium.
